I am planning to use SonarLint for Java projects (in connected mode) and I would like to know about the major known limitations before starting with it.
Ones I know are:
1. Does not support some third party analyzers e.g. FindBugs, PMD etc.
2. Does not indicate code coverage.
3. Does not indicate code duplications.

Are there any others? I have also seen some people complaining about performance issue when using this plugin..

I would clarify the first point: does not support *any* third party analyzers. Only SonarSource ones. I don't recall other major limitations than the ones you listed.

Although we have seen performance problems in rare isolated cases, we are not aware of performance issues in general. Performance is very important to us, and we would do our best to fix whenever it's reported.
